organic pesticides ingredients

formik confirmation dialog

Is there a builtin confirmation dialog in Windows Forms? Props of the native component are also available. In a windows form application, you can create confirmation dialogs to display a message to the user and wait for their response. It reset the form. Our confirmation dialog will display all form fields that contain values (leaving any fields without values hidden). Making statements based on opinion; back them up with references or personal experience. Connect Telegram Bot with Google Sheet API in node.js(2), How to Integrate React Native Web into React Native Apps, Rendering, Two Waves, and the Future of JavaScript SEO, How to change Philips Hue lights color depending on air pollution, How to Load JSON Data to a Flutter DataGrid, Firebase Push Notification in Ionic React app using Capacitor, , // save original callback with event in closure, hide = () => this.setState({ open: false, callback: null }). Additionally, if you need show a simple confirmation dialog, you can use antd.Modal.confirm (), and so on. This package is a simple wrapper for material-table-core. Thanks for contributing an answer to Stack Overflow! const [handleResetForm, setHandleResetForm] = useState< () => void> (); const handleSubmit = (values: FormValues, resetForm: () => void) => { setShowDialog (true); setSendParams (values); setHandleResetForm (resetForm); }; Sorry for the mess, any advice would be appreciated! Validation is done with the Yup object schema validator which hooks into Formik via the handy validationSchema prop. To submit a form in Formik, you need to somehow fire off the provided handleSubmit (e) or submitForm prop. How to turn it into a reusable component? MUI Paper in the DOM. formik form reset after form submit react js. Replacing outdoor electrical box at end of conduit. Yeah you could do that, but Formik already have, I updated my answer with a possible solution if you really want to use, Thanks a lot for looking at the source code, that looks like a Formik limitation. How to dynamically show hide Formik form field depending on another form field. Formik - How to reset form after confirmation,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Now you want to add a confirmation step. Math papers where the only issue is that someone else could've done it but didn't, Non-anthropic, universal units of time for active SETI. Parameters. There are three variants; a typed, drawn or uploaded signature. Formik - How to reset form after confirmation, How to reset / empty form after submit in Formik. It will clear any errors you have. I wanted to use my own modal so I used, You can create a function component like this, Now Import this function component inside your. In the simplest way you can write just validationSchema and pass it as prop to <Formik /> component. What is the easiest way to show a confirmation dialog in react-admin? ReactJS Form Validation using Formik and Yup - GeeksforGeeks In this article,we'll be implementing a reusable and modular confirmation dialogue in Vue.js. With Yup, we can create schema for validation abstractly instead of creating custom validation for each input field. React + Formik Dynamic Form Example | Jason Watmore's Blog Instead, we can spend more time on logic. How to prevent React-Final-Form to reset the form values after user submits the form? Next.js: Next.js. 2. Can an autistic person with difficulty making eye contact survive in the workplace? User53115 posted. How do you disable browser autocomplete on web form field / input tags? Formik - How to reset form after confirmation - Stack Overflow Build and validate forms in React Native using Formik and Yup Imperatively reset the form. Material Table Core Formik with Dialogs - GitHub Pooling of synthetic events. Math papers where the only issue is that someone else could've done it but didn't. I used resetForm() on child component, it actually worked, but when click on the button on child Component, resetForm works. How to reset a form after clicking submit button by using react? Saving for retirement starting at 68 years old. Add Formik to the login form Formik is a small library that helps forms to be organized in React and React Native by implementing the following: it keeps track of a form's state handles form submission via reusable methods and handlers (such as handleChange, handleBlur, and handleSubmit) handles validation and error messages out of the box Product Bundles. It sets isSubmitting to false and isValidating to false. Making statements based on opinion; back them up with references or personal experience. My code below still resets the form even when you click Cancel. What I do in cases like that is push the page modally, and add a Cancel toolbar item. This is just a basic confirm dialog, you can modify it to meet your needs, such as changing the Yes or No buttons. Not sure why, but even when I dont get any error or warning about Event being reused, it still returns the current target value. The app component contains Form Validation example built with Formik and Yup library. Reactjs Formik How to Reset Form After Confirmation - signNow Copyright 2022 www.appsloveworld.com. This example use Formik, Redux, Yup for client side validation, and Material UI for design. Form Submission | Formik How can we hold/persist the selected dropdown value after submit and reset the textarea in react hooks form, formik form reset after form submit react js. The confirm button label. Javascript confirmation dialog box - W3schools Add confirmation dialog to React events | by Tom Ehrlich | ITNEXT Modal - Ant Design In this video we go over:- What is Formik and how does it work with MUI?- Why Formik for Material UI Forms?- How does Formik integrate with MUI- What informa. Let me know here or at Twitter: Hey! What is Formik? The implementation is straightforward. When form is submitted, handleSubmit event handler is called, something happens. It displays dialogs instead of the inline edit for the Add, Update and Delete actions. Why don't we know exactly where the Chinese rocket will fall? React app is not reacting to changes as expected. The Formik source code seems to indicate resetForm() will be called no matter what your onReset() function returns. The library solves i18n from beginning to the end, providing components for translation, CLI for managing message catalogs and compiles messages offline to save bundle size. I would still go with the first solution though personally. rev2022.11.3.43005. Override or extend the styles applied to the component. React Hook Form: React Hook Form 7, 6. You could probably just create a different handler, which opens a modal and add handleSubmit handler to submit button inside modal: something like this. Using Formik means we will spend very little time managing states, handling errors, change handlers, etc. What is a Form Confirmation Dialog? - Documentation With Formik, this is just a few lines of code. How to segregate the value of a JavaScript objects into Array efficiently? }, []); const setformstate = react.usecallback((id: string, state: formikcontext) => { setformstates(produce((draft: aggregatestate) => { if (idrefs.current.has(id)) draft[id] = state; else throw new error(`form $ {id} does not exist, make sure you have called \`createformstate\` before this action.`); })); }, []); const clearformstate = Devise DELETE /users/sign_out returns status 204 and doesn't redirect?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Also there have to have two string values passing in to the custom confirm dialog. Tutorial | Formik So in this formik yup confirm password validation, you will learn it from step by step. How to clear form after successfully submitting Formik form using redux, React formik form validation: How to initially have submit button disabled, How to submit the form by Material UI Dialog using ReactJS. What exactly makes a black hole STAY a black hole? Repeat the function with onMouseDown in React, React child component does not re-render after useState variable is updated on each iteration of a loop. Its well documented and it might be removed in future versions, but for now we have to deal with it. As you can see from the following query, you must use the below SQL Script to create the required ReactDB Database. Sorry for the mess, What is a good way to make an abstract board game truly alien? React FormIk reset values to empty values handleReset function. Why so many wires in my old light fixture? React Password and Confirm Password Validation using Yup - CodeCheef JavaScript post request like a form submit, How to reset a form using jQuery with .reset() method. Javascript confirmation dialog box. How to warn user with unsaved changes? Issue #1657 jaredpalmer/formik How to force a compilation and ignore @typescript-eslint errors? setOpen This is a state function that will set the state of the dialog to show or close. Why does the sentence uses a question form, but it is put a period in the end? I would still go with the first solution though personally. Read more in Telerik UI for Blazor Documentation. Simple. onSubmit= { (values, { resetForm }) => {. However, for anyone using useFormik hook and wanting to clear form on 'reset' button click, here's one way to achieve that. Uses the built-in React inputs: input, select, and textarea to build a form with no validation. Maybe to encourage user to double check entered data or just inform them politely whats gonna happen. In Formik, how to make the Reset button reset the form only after confirmation? Im full-stack developer and in my free time Im working on LinguiJS, the i18n library for JavaScript. LO Writer: Easiest way to put line of words into table as rows (list). Forms must tell users which fields are required, the type of values allowed in certain fields. Fortunately, Formik itself allows to use Yup validation library by default. Javascript confirmation dialog box is used to display a message to the user for confirming something. Then the state will update without us writing much code. Or a better way in general to handle confirmation? Its alternative to react-intl, but also works with vanilla JS. Creating React Forms with Formik - Medium To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Why are statistics slower to build on clustered columnstore? In this tutorial, we'll cover how to use Formik, Yup and material-ui for our React Forms. open This is what tells the dialog to show. How to properly make navbar stay fixed at top of screen? Something like this: If you really want to use onReset, I think the only way is to throw an error. Adds a dismissable close button to the confirm dialog. Passing multiple actions to mapDispatchToProps in Redux. How to convert a buffer array into an image. Follow the step-by-step instructions below to eSign your reactjs formik how to reset form after confirmation : Select the document you want to sign and click Upload. Connect and share knowledge within a single location that is structured and easy to search. To learn more, see our tips on writing great answers. Formik contains a higher order component that helps with managing react state, validation, error messages and form submission. How to disable formik form after submission of form? useFormikContext () You can create a function component like this let resetPresForm = {};// You will have to define this before useEffect const ResettingForm = () => { const { resetForm } = useFormikContext (); resetPresForm = resetForm; // Store the value of resetForm in this variable return null; }; Does a creature have to see to be affected by the Fear spell initially since it is an illusion? Easy way to make a confirmation dialog in Angular? Webpack failed to load resource. Whats great that we can use this render prop component to intercept any React event, like button click: The API looks good and clean, so whats the catch? Then I discovered the problem with event pooling, but I can live with it. Blazor Confirm Dialog Component | BlazorBootstrap In Formik, how to make the Reset button reset the form only after confirmation?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. 2022 Moderator Election Q&A Question Collection. [Solved]-Formik: How to reset form after confirming on dialog-Reactjs Telerik UI for Blazor . When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. How to reset form in formik using enableReinitialize? The message to be displayed in the confirmation dialog. Create your eSignature and click Ok. Press Done. Check The Password Confirmation With Yup - Today I Learned - Hashrocket Add a form to your landing page, and from the Form Confirmation section, click Show form confirmation dialog: Next, click the Form Confirmation Dialog tab in the top left corner of the Classic Builder: A default Form Confirmation Dialog will appear: Like editing your landing page, you can edit and style your Form Confirmation Dialog to your . See CSS API below for more details. I am new to C# Development. First one is this.confirm, which should call the original handler with original event and close the modal: We solved the problem with event in openConfirmationModal so right now we just call the event we stored in closure and hide the modal. Access nested array value inside other array in the stateful ReactJS component, i am trying to upload file using react hook form and i used useController function and i am getting error, CKEditor 5 image upload error in React Js, Panel header size is not changing in React-Bootstrap, Refresh component after remove an object - ReactJS, PhpStorm - how to turn off automatic curly brace insertion. How do I reset select elements in a React form after submission? Material Table Core Formik with Dialogs. Creating a Confirm Dialog in React and Material UI - Plain English The latter is useful for calling resetForm within componentWillReceiveProps. How to clear react-select value after formik form submission? Is it considered harrassment in the US to call a black man the N-word? Are Githyanki under Nondetection all the time? A short example of render prop component which adds a confirmation step to any React event, like form submit or button click. React + Formik: Formik 1.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? How to manipulate state of parent component from child in react, Dynamically add children to React components. 11 Ciarn Tobin I understand OP's question was for Formik. In order to add a nice. In order to validate our forms, we will use Yup with Formik validationSchema. Submit form with confirmation dialog (MVC) How to distinguish it-cleft and extraposition? I came to this article looking for this answer. Additionally, it allows the validation with Formik and YUP for these actions as well. Enable delete confirmation dialog in Grid for Blazor. React Form Validation example with Hooks, Formik and Yup Formik is a library for building forms in React. In this tutorial, we'll walk through the steps of creating an easy confirmation modal dialog with C# ASP .NET MVC3, jQuery, and jQuery UI. - text: String. If youre into i18n, check out LinguiJS v2.7 which was released this week including macros for internationalization (pluggable compile-time plugins for babel-plugin-macros by Kent C. Dodds): If youre interested in stuff I do and articles I write, follow me on Twitter: ITNEXT is a platform for IT developers & software engineers to share knowledge, connect, collaborate, learn and experience next-gen technologies. , handleSubmit event handler is called, something happens hide Formik form submission ''. The styles applied to the confirm dialog no matter what your onReset ( ) function returns confirmation step to react... Synthetic events line of words into Table as rows ( list ) typescript-eslint errors sentence uses question. S question was for Formik this article looking for this answer > < /a > with,. Working on LinguiJS, the i18n library for JavaScript at top of screen papers. Messages and form submission is it considered harrassment in the end making statements based on opinion back! You disable browser autocomplete on web form field / input tags Core Formik with dialogs - GitHub < /a with... 'Ve done it but did n't first solution though personally values to values. With it edit for the mess, what is the easiest way to show or close the only is! The app component contains form validation example built with Formik and Yup library an autistic person with difficulty eye! Feed, copy and paste this URL into your RSS reader no validation properly navbar. I18N library for JavaScript the end it might be removed in future,! And isValidating to false as prop to & lt ; Formik / & ;... It as prop to & lt ; Formik / & gt ; component or better! What exactly makes a black hole STAY a black man the N-word this RSS feed, copy and this! Light fixture Script to create the required ReactDB Database # 1657 jaredpalmer/formik < /a how! To changes as expected will display all form fields that contain values ( leaving any fields without values hidden.... And Material UI for design why so many wires in my free im... Go with the first solution though personally button to the component convert buffer. Reset button reset the form issue is that someone else could 've done but. Mess, what is the easiest way to show a confirmation step to any react event, like submit! 1657 jaredpalmer/formik < /a > Pooling of synthetic events difficulty making eye contact survive in the workplace matter what onReset... //Stackoverflow.Com/Questions/66593575/Formik-How-To-Reset-Form-After-Confirming-On-Dialog '' > < /a > how to properly make navbar STAY fixed at of. A message to the user and wait for their response reset values to empty values handleReset function lt Formik... You disable browser autocomplete on web form field depending on another form field on. With event Pooling, but also works with formik confirmation dialog JS URL into your RSS reader and share knowledge a... I think the only way is to throw an error our react forms still. Yup object schema validator which hooks into Formik via the handy validationSchema.. Only way is to throw an error handleSubmit ( e ) or prop... Submit button by using react for design Formik and Yup for these actions as well the ''. React app is not reacting to changes as expected what your onReset ( ), so! In cases like that is structured and easy to search for this answer which adds a confirmation in... On opinion ; back them up with references or personal experience in Formik to confirmation. Warn user with unsaved changes to him to fix the machine '' our tips on great! Like form submit or button click can an autistic person with difficulty making eye contact survive in the end each! To force a compilation and ignore @ typescript-eslint errors reset values to empty values handleReset function which hooks Formik! Reactdb Database Update without us writing much code this URL into your RSS reader of?. Exactly where the Chinese rocket will fall confirmation step to any react event, form. Edit for the add, Update and Delete actions is a form in Formik, this is state. Web form field depending on another form field / input tags way you can create schema validation. Do you disable browser autocomplete on web form field / input tags will be called matter! Did n't free time im working on LinguiJS, the i18n library JavaScript!, 6, this is what tells the dialog to show a confirmation dialog order component helps. And ignore @ typescript-eslint errors the easiest way to show a confirmation step any... Issue is that someone else could 've done it but did n't and form submission value! That is push the page modally, and so on a black hole Cancel! As well contains form validation example built with Formik, how to user... Display a message to the user and wait for their response of screen will display all form that! Url into your RSS reader copy and paste this URL into your RSS reader step to any react event like! To be displayed in the workplace of synthetic events or personal experience the custom confirm.... '' > how to force a compilation and ignore @ typescript-eslint errors textarea to build a form confirmation dialog is! Into Array efficiently an image do you disable browser autocomplete on web field! The component off the provided handleSubmit ( e ) or submitForm prop { (,! Or submitForm formik confirmation dialog wires in my old light fixture future versions, it... Gon na happen of conduit in order to validate our forms, we will use Yup Formik. Seems to indicate resetForm ( ) will be called no matter what your onReset ( function... Of conduit na happen Pooling of synthetic events entered data or just inform them politely whats gon na happen show... Our tips on writing great answers would still go with the first solution though personally - Documentation < >... Write just validationSchema and pass it as prop to & lt ; Formik / & gt {! No matter what your onReset ( ), and textarea to build on clustered?..., see our tips on writing great answers dialogs instead of creating custom validation each... The app component contains form validation example built with Formik and Yup for these actions well! Only after confirmation on another form field / input tags, you can create schema for validation abstractly instead creating... Question was for Formik no matter what your onReset ( ) will be called no matter what onReset... Data or just inform them politely whats gon na happen paste this URL into your RSS reader a,! Synthetic events makes a black man the N-word top of screen way is to throw an.! Line of words into Table as rows ( list ) words into as. Outdoor electrical box at end of conduit and share knowledge within a single location that is structured and easy search! The built-in react inputs: input, select, and so on there have to have string! Values to empty values handleReset function it is put a period in the simplest way you create. But did n't changes as expected does the sentence uses a question form, but I can live with.! Was for Formik it considered harrassment in the workplace passing in to the dialog. And form submission to search is structured and easy to search discovered the problem with event Pooling but! Function returns inline edit for the add, Update and Delete actions that will set the state will without..., how to reset a form after submit in Formik, Redux Yup... Developer and in my old light fixture, Formik itself allows to use Yup library. Field / input tags vanilla JS now we have to have two string values passing in to the confirm. React event, like form submit or button click reset a form after clicking submit button by using?... When form is submitted, handleSubmit event handler is called, something happens a dismissable close button to component... Yup library example use Formik, how to reset the form values after user submits the form only after,. Our react forms throw an error at end of conduit encourage user to check! Use the below SQL Script to create the required ReactDB Database see our on! ) = & gt ; component us writing much code a short example of render prop which! Will fall a simple confirmation dialog prevent React-Final-Form to reset a form with no validation the handy validationSchema.! - Documentation < /a > with Formik and Yup library like form submit or button click button... Now we have to deal with it might be removed in future versions, but for now have. Dialog, you can see from the following query, you must use the below SQL to! Stay fixed at top of screen validation with Formik and Yup library following query, you use! Need show a simple confirmation dialog box is used to display a message to the user and wait for response. At Twitter: Hey, we will use Yup with Formik, this a..., handleSubmit event handler is called, something happens > what is a good way to put line of into! Actions formik confirmation dialog well great answers fix the machine '' and `` it 's down him... Styles applied to the component an abstract board game truly alien us writing much code a! This example use Formik, this is just a few lines of code versions, but for now we to... Confirmation, how to force a compilation and ignore @ typescript-eslint errors the N-word, it allows validation! Man the N-word override or extend the styles applied to the user and wait for their response using react to... Form submission the N-word understand OP & # x27 ; s question was for Formik fire off provided. User for confirming something > how to clear react-select value after Formik form field all form fields that values. I reset select elements in a react form after submission of form user to double check data. With unsaved changes is put a period in the end considered harrassment in the simplest way you can write validationSchema.

4300 Londonderry Road Harrisburg, Pa 17109, 401k Announcement Flyer, Sheet Music Un Dia De Noviembre, Associate Prm Certification Value, Butter Replacement In Cooking, How To Keep Flies Off Dogs Outside, Canis Major Dwarf Galaxy, How To Make A Permissions Plugin Minecraft,

formik confirmation dialog